GAI Consultants is seeking an Environmental Manager to work out of one of our three main Indiana offices located in Fishers Fort Wayne or Indianapolis. You will be responsible for overseeing the preparation of environmental studies wetland delineations permitting (NEPA CEs EAs Construction in a Floodway Indiana Department of Environmental Management (IDEM) 401 United States Army Corps 404 IDEM Rule 5 etc. and mitigation plans and monitoring and Section 106 regulations. Our clients include the Indiana Department of Transportation (INDOT) counties cities towns and utility companies across Indiana.
Job Duties:
- Provide project experience with environmental permitting (local state and federal) and compliance support for key segments of the infrastructure industry.
- Coordinate interdisciplinary work teams and overall task management of field efforts for erosion control monitoring wetland and stream delineations and endangered species surveys and monitoring.
- Oversee the completion and management of the preparation of permit applications and associated environmental reporting.
- Prepare scope and fee proposals.
- Conduct quality control reviews.
- Control expenditures within limitations of project/task budget and monitor budget status.
- Interface with customers as necessary to ensure customer needs are met.
- Manage subconsultants as required.
- Provide regular status and progress reports to the project manager and/or client.
- Experience in team leadership staff mentoring and project management
- Mentor and direct junior environmental staff.
- Ability to demonstrate strong writing and verbal communication skills.
- Technical understanding of natural resources and field assessment methodologies.
- Read analyze and interpret general business documents technical procedures and governmental regulations.
- Familiarity with INDOT Consultant Performance Evaluation criteria for Environmental Documents and NEPArelated Performance types.
- Experience with environmental permitting/consultations and regulatory agencies in Indiana and/or neighboring states.
